In 1905, Lillian E BARNES entered the world in St Louis, Missouri, USA, born to Frank H Barnes And Frances Marie Schless Barnes Cashen. In 1910, Lillian E BARNES resided in St Louis Ward 13, Saint Louis City, Missouri, USA. In 1920, Lillian E BARNES resided in St Louis Ward 24, St Louis (Independent City), Mis. Lillian E BARNES married Paul Edward Keary. Lillian E BARNES passed away in 1985 in Affton, St. Louis County, Missouri, United States of America.
